Story summary
  • The LOFAR Two-metre Sky Survey (LoTSS-DR3) released data revealing nearly 13.7 million celestial objects across 88% of the northern sky.
  • Researchers collected 13,000 hours of observations and processed 18.6 petabytes of data using 70,000 antennas.
  • The data are publicly available and enable studies of supermassive black holes and exoplanets.
  • The findings were published in Astronomy & Astrophysics.
  • LOFAR sets the stage for the upcoming Square Kilometre Array Observatory.
